A patient comes in for an outpatient EGD with biopsy. While in recovery following the procedure, the patient begins complaining of severe chest pain and is taken to the cath lab. A left heart cath with coronoary angiography is performed and a stent is inserted into the left circumflex artery. Additionally, an atherectomy of the left anterior descending artery is performed. The patient is placed in observation overnight and discharged the next day. What CPT procedure code(s), sequencing, and modifiers apply? Group of answer choices 93458-LT, 92933-LT, 43239 43239, 92924-LD, 92928-LC, 93458 92928, 92924, 43239 92920, 92928, 93458, 43239
